       The New Economy Technology Scholarship Act (24 P. S. §§ 5199.1--5199.9) established an incentive scholarship program for Pennsylvania students to pursue higher education and training in science and technology fields to create a sustained pool of highly trained technology workers to improve the Commonwealth's ability to attract and retain business. The act defines an approved course of study as ''A program or curriculum offered by a postsecondary educational institution that provides instruction in science, technology and related fields and has been approved by the Department of Education (Department) in consultation with the Pennsylvania Workforce Investment Board.''

       As part of the review process of the approved courses of study, the Department will accept written public comments from institutions, groups or individuals between the date of publication of this notice and October 1, 2000. Comments should address whether courses of study currently on the approved list for scholarships should continue to be approved, and/or whether the addition or deletion of specific courses of study would affect the purposes of the act.

       All written comments shall be filed with Dr. Warren D. Evans, Chartering/Governance/Accreditation Specialist, 333 Market Street, Harrisburg, PA 17126-0333, (717) 787-7572; Fax: (717) 783-0583, or by e-mail addressed to wevans@state.pa.us, on or before 4 p.m. on October 1, 2000.

       All public comments will be considered as part of the review. Any recommendations regarding the addition or deletion of a program will be coordinated with Commonwealth workforce needs as identified in the targeted industry clusters and meetings with industry representatives. The list of approved courses of study, including any revisions as a result of the review, will appear on the New Economy Technology Scholarship Application for the 2001-2002 academic year.
